Health Professions is a broad operational area that includes occupational therapists, dietitians, wellness consultants, physiotherapists, social workers, speech-language pathologists, psychologists, and care coordinators. Our unit managers have shared positions and are therefore well anchored in the clinic. The department has twice won the region's award "Gyllene Äpplet" (Golden Apple), which is given to recognize developmental initiatives at both management and employee levels. Licensed Occupational Therapist for departments C5 and E4, two medical departments at Södertälje Hospital: As an occupational therapist with us, you'll be part of a small group of occupational therapists, some of whom work in outpatient care and several in inpatient care. We work closely together and help each other between departments as part of our daily work. Your main placement will be in medical inpatient care. You will spend the majority of your placement on a medical department specializing in stroke and other neurological diseases. A smaller part of the position includes work on a care unit specializing in cardiovascular diseases. You take responsibility for and perform occupational therapy interventions based on planning on your departments. Your tasks include assessing your patients' activity levels and living situations, performing ADL (Activities of Daily Living) assessments and training, assessing needs for and testing assistive devices, conducting cognitive assessments and assessments of physical function such as hand status, and when needed, making home visits. Your tasks also include collaboration with the patient and their family/loved ones, the department's other professions, our discharge team, and other parts of the rehabilitation chain. ABOUT US At Pärlans Konfektyr, we cook candy, candy sauce, and other sweets using pure, simple ingredients according to classic artisan methods. Quality and craftsmanship are our most important guiding principles in creating new, exciting, and unusually delicious taste experiences through confectionery. Today, our factory with production and offices is located in the Slakthusområdet area south of Stockholm. In addition to our own stores, our products can be purchased from retailers in Sweden and internationally. Besides our candies, we also have our own soft ice cream in our store, which has become a success – and we manage to break sales records year after year. The Swedish Pensions Agency is responsible for the general pension and provides information about the entire pension. Every year we pay out approximately 415 billion kronor to 2.3 million pensioners, and send out 8 million orange envelopes. We have approximately 25 million digital customer contacts per year. We have approximately 1,700 employees at eight locations, from Luleå in the north to Halmstad in the south. We make the pension simpler. #LI-HYBRID
